turned out great. I had to make the dovetail connections because I don't think they are included anywhere. I used snipps to round off the backs of the springs so they would rest flat in the designated slot and the glue would set properly. takes a bit of extra time but it saves time in the end trying to squeeze them into their spots and not glue properly and pop out.

I had a hard time with this. pieces did not line up at all. not sure if it's because I used 2 different brands of black PETG and some warping occurred on some pieces or what. looks good from a distance. some alignment markers would help out a lot to glue the fist few parts so it's centered correctly.
